Uplift modeling is used extensively to identify treatment candidates that are more likely to benefit from an intervention. However, the fairness evaluation of such models remains a challenge due to the lack of ground truth on the outcome measure since a candidate cannot be in both treatment and control simultaneously. In this paper, we propose a framework that generates surrogate ground truth to serve as a proxy for counterfactual labels of uplift modeling campaigns. We then leverage the surrogate ground truth to conduct a more comprehensive binary fairness evaluation. We show how to apply the approach in a real-world marketing campaign for promotional offers and demonstrate its enhancement for fairness evaluation.
